Chef’s Notes: Nutty Oat Breakfast Muffins

• For extra moisture, replace half the milk with plain Greek yogurt – This adds creaminess and depth to the texture.

• Pair with a balanced brunch spread – These muffins go well with scrambled eggs or a fresh fruit salad for a nutritious start.

• Customize mix-ins – Stir in mini chocolate chips, dried cranberries, or shredded apples for added flavor and texture.

• Maintain ingredient temperature – Bring all ingredients to room temperature for even mixing and better consistency.

• Avoid over-stirring – Gently folding the batter prevents toughness and keeps muffins light and fluffy.

• Optimize storage for freshness – Keep in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days, or freeze for longer shelf life.

• Make-ahead friendly – Freeze cooled muffins individually in parchment for grab-and-go breakfasts—thaw in a toaster oven or microwave.

• Boost nutrition – Swap whole milk for almond or soy milk and add flaxseed for extra fiber and protein.

• Use a toothpick test – Checking at 12 minutes ensures muffins are perfectly baked without drying out.

• Experiment with alternative toppings – Sprinkle chopped nuts, cinnamon sugar, or rolled oats on top for a bakery-style finish.

Ingredients

  • Dry Ingredients
  • 1/2 cup unbleached all-purpose flour spooned and leveled for consistent rise

  • 1/4 cup rolled oats for chewy texture

  • 1/4 cup light brown sugar for natural sweetness

  • 1 tsp baking powder to lift the crumb

  • 1/4 tsp sea salt to balance the flavors

  • Pinch ground cinnamon for warmth

  • Wet Ingredients
  • 1 large free-range egg lightly beaten

  • 1 tbsp natural creamy peanut butter smooth or crunchy

  • 1/2 cup whole milk or almond milk for dairy-free

  • 3 tbsp roasted peanuts chopped, optional for extra crunch

  • Alternative Ingredients
  • Unbleached all-purpose flour: swap for a 1-to-1 gluten-free flour mix for gluten-free diets.

  • Rolled oats: use certified gluten-free oats if needed.

  • Light brown sugar: replace with coconut sugar or reduce milk by 1 tbsp and use maple syrup.

  • Natural peanut butter: substitute almond butter or sunflower seed butter for nut allergies.

  • Whole milk: use soy oat, or cashew milk to make the recipe dairy-free.

  • Egg: mix 1 tbsp ground flaxseed with 3 tbsp water to make a vegan “flax egg.”

  • Roasted peanuts: switch to pumpkin seeds or chopped almonds for different textures.

Directions

  • Dry Mix Prep – In a large bowl, whisk flour, oats, brown sugar, baking powder, salt, and cinnamon until evenly combined. This takes about 4 minutes and ensures uniform leavening. Even distribution of baking powder prevents uneven muffin tops.nutty-oat-breakfast-muffins_post
  • Wet Blend – In a separate bowl, lightly beat the egg, then stir in peanut butter and milk until smooth. Allocate 2 minutes for this step to fully integrate the nut butter. A well-emulsified wet mix creates a tender crumb.
  • Batter Assembly – Combine wet ingredients with dry by folding gently with a silicone spatula for about 30 seconds, stopping when streaks of flour vanish. Overmixing develops gluten and yields tough muffins. Optionally, rest batter 5 minutes to let oats hydrate for a moister texture.nutty-oat-breakfast-muffins_post2
  • Fill Bake – Preheat oven to 375°F, grease or line a 4-cup muffin pan, and spoon 1/3 cup of batter into each cup. Bake on the center rack for 15 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ean, checking at 12 minutes for doneness. Rotating the pan halfway ensures even browning.
  • Cool Serve – Allow muffins to rest in the pan for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ely. This brief rest prevents soggy bottoms by releasing steam. Serve warm, store in an airtight container up to 3 days, or freeze for grab-and-go breakfasts.Nutty Oat Breakfast Muffins

Notes

    • For extra moisture, replace half the milk with plain Greek yogurt and reduce bake time by 2 minutes.
    • These muffins are a great side for scrambled eggs or a fruit salad at brunch.
    • Stir in mini chocolate chips, dried cranberries, or shredded apples for added flavor.
    • Ensure your ingredients are at room temperature for even mixing and avoid over-stirring to keep muffins tender.
    • Freeze cooled muffins individually in parchment for easy breakfasts—thaw in a toaster oven or microwave.

FAQs: Nutty Oat Breakfast Muffins

Can I make these gluten-free?

Yes! Use a 1-to-1 gluten-free flour blend and certified gluten-free oats.

How should I store leftovers?

Store in an airtight container for up to three days, or freeze for later use.

Can I replace peanut butter with another spread?

Absolutely! Almond butter, sunflower seed butter, or even tahini work well.

What’s the best way to reheat frozen muffins?

Thaw overnight or warm in the microwave for 20 seconds.

Can I make these vegan?

Yes! Use a flax egg and almond milk to keep them entirely plant-based.

Do I need to rest the batter before baking?

Resting for 5 minutes hydrates the oats, making the muffins moister.

Can I use a different sweetener?

Yes! Swap brown sugar for maple syrup or coconut sugar for a refined sugar-free version.

Can I bake these in a loaf pan instead of a muffin tin?

Yes! Bake at the same temperature but extend the cook time to about 25 minutes.

What’s a good topping idea?

Try a sprinkle of cinnamon sugar or crushed peanuts for added texture.

Can I double the recipe for meal prep?

Of course! Just use a larger mixing bowl and adjust bake time slightly.
